Franklin Foundation Hospital Benefits’ Preview
Franklin Foundation Hospital offers a wide variety of employee benefits to full-time and regular part-time employees. Each employee is able to choose those benefits that satisfy their needs, and at a reasonable price. Each benefit has its own eligibility requirements and terms and conditions. Most benefits have a ninety day waiting period; however, there are some that are effective immediately.

Franklin Foundation has a 125k Cafeteria Plan. This is a plan that allows certain benefits to be pre-taxed. In other words, employees do not pay taxes on their premiums for covered benefits. You only pay taxes when you receive the benefits.

Employee Group Medical – your medical coverage is provided by the Aetna Life Insurance Company. Your plan has four tiers: employee, employee and spouse, employee with children(s), and family. Annual premiums are shared by you and Franklin Foundation Hospital. You must be employed by the hospital for ninety days to become eligible to participate.

Employee Dental - is a voluntary benefit. Your provider is Ameritas. You may purchase dental insurance for yourself and family.

Employee Group Life Insurance - group life insurance for employees is purchased by the hospital. Employees are covered at one and a half times their straight time annual income.

Employee Retirement Plan – employees may contribute to their retirement plan beginning the first pay period after they have been hired. You can contribute from 0% up to 100 % of your salary or wages. Your contributions are pre-taxed, in other words, you do not pay taxes on your contributions until you take distribution, except for rollovers. Franklin Foundation Hospital will also match the first 100% of the first 2% of your
compensation. By law, certain limits apply to your compensation and contributions. Your contributions will always be yours, however, the matching contributions made by the Franklin Foundation Hospital will be vested beginning after the first year of service and fully vested once you have achieved five years of service with the hospital.

Employee Long Term Disability – is a voluntary benefit. Your provider is the Aetna Life Insurance Company. Employees pay the entire premium.

Employee Voluntary Life and Accidental Death and Dismemberment - is a voluntary benefit. Employees can purchase additional life insurance on himself and coverage for his spouse and/or children.

Aflac Plans - Aflac has a variety of insurance protection plans which you may choose from. All premiums are at group rates which make them affordable. Covered plans are:

Cancer Indemnity
Short Term Disability
Accident Indemnity
Special Event Protection
Hospital Indemnity
Vision

Each plan has its on set of terms and conditions.

On the date of your initial orientation a Human Resource representative will give you an overview of each benefit, and during your benefits orientation, our benefits’ coordinator will discuss in detail each benefit and its cost.
